Clinical Tips: FenderWedge
Bur damage to adjacent teeth is a common problem in everyday dental practice. Research shows that 70% of adjacent teeth suffer damage during class II preparations.* FenderWedge prevents damage to the adjacent tooth and gingiva that commonly occurs during Class II preparations. FenderWedge is a combination of a steel plate and a plastic wedge. It facilitates easy application of a matrix. To avoid aspiration it is recommended to secure FenderWedge with a waxed dental floss. > Read more about the importance of protecting the adjacent tooth.

Clinical Tips: Spotit
Before cementation of conventional crowns, bridges and implant prosthetics, it is necessary to assess the relationship of the crown to the neighboring teeth. Occlusion paper is often used to check the contact point. This method however shows a too broad and inaccurate contact point with the subsequent risk of excessive adjustment, often resulting in too large contact point. Spotit simplifies adjustment of C&B contact points helping with exact indication of contact points. As the marker traverses the contact between the prosthetic element and the adjacent tooth it leaves a clear and accurate indication of the adjustment needed for a perfect contact point. > Time-saving and accurate with Spotit.
Clinical Tips: ANA Etching Gel
ANA Etching Gel is an enamel and dentine etchant with 37% concentration of phosphoric acid. It is a well established fact that etching materials should contain 35-40% phosphoric acid. ANA Etching Gel stays in place without collapsing. The ideal viscosity in combination with the blue colour enables very precise and clearly detectable placement. The thin bendable needles allow accurate application. Very easy and fast to rinse off. > ANA Etching Gel and it’s texture is perfect for any way of etching.
